Port Dufferin West is a locality in Halifax, Nova Scotia, Canada. It is classified as a town. Port Dufferin West is located at 44.9038°N, 62.3987°W. It observes Atlantic Time (UTC−4 / −3). Postal code area: B0J.
Port Dufferin West rests upon the rugged Atlantic coast, where the land rises into the quiet elevations of Quoddy Hill. It lies 42.1 km south-west of Sherbrooke, NS (from Sherbrooke, NS: bearing 231°T), and is situated 11.1 km east of Sheet Harbour. The Salmon River winds through this terrain, its currents carrying the cold, salt-tinged breath of the ocean toward the interior.
